Child Support Modification: When and How to Request It

Life's circumstances often change , and minor’s support arrangements may need to be modified accordingly. A substantial change in either parent’s income or the child’s needs can be grounds for requesting a modification. Usual examples include job layoff, a raise resulting in increased income, or substantial changes in healthcare expenses . To start the process, you'll generally need to file a written request with the regional family court. The tribunal will then set a proceeding where both parents can provide evidence to support their arguments . It’s very advisable to obtain legal guidance before proceeding, as regulations vary by state .

Understanding Child Support Orders: Your Rights and Responsibilities

Navigating a child support determination can feel complicated , but it’s vital to comprehend your obligations and duties . The child support determination is a judicial decision that establishes the financial responsibility of custodial parents for providing for their children . Generally, the figure is calculated based on factors such as income , parenting time , and the amount of children involved . One have the entitlement to obtain understanding of the ruling and to consider change if conditions evolve.

  • Examine the full determination carefully.
  • Maintain accurate data of transfers made and received.
  • Handle any conflicts through the proper court process .
  • Obtain counsel from a lawyer if you have questions .
Failure to follow to a child support determination can have serious penalties including financial deductions and court sanctions.

Can You Lower Child Support? Common Reasons for Modification

Navigating child support arrangement can be complex, and events often shift. Wondering if you can lower your payment? It’s possible, but requires proving a significant change in relevant elements.

  • Financial loss: A significant reduction in wages due to employment loss, illness issues, or condition is a frequent reason.
  • Parenting agreements: Changes to a caretaker's work or relocation that affect custodial responsibilities can be evaluated.
  • Minor's needs: Substantial changes in a child's economic demands, such as extensive healthcare expenses or educational costs, may be taken into consideration.
Keep in mind that just hoping a reduced maintenance is not usually adequate; you need to prove a change to judge.
